Workwell

The Workplace Safety & Insurance Board (WSIB) has developed a workplace inspection audit program called Workwell. WorkWell conducts Health & Safety audits of firms with poor safety records with a focus on encouraging the development of an effective internal responsibility system in the workplace. The Workwell Program consists of:

  • A comprehensive audit of a workplace's Health & Safety management system
  • Six-month grace period to correct deficiencies
  • A follow-up audit to determine results

Failure of the second audit carries with it financial implications with potential surcharges of up to $500,000 in some instances.
